




1969 Rolex Oyster Perpetual 1500 - Lavender Dial
Lavender by design, rarely seen
This Rolex Oyster Perpetual from 1969 stands out immediately for its factory lavender dial — a color Rolex produced in very limited numbers and one that rarely surfaces today. Subtle, soft, and unmistakably period-correct, it offers a completely different presence than the silver, black, or blue dials most people associate with this reference.
It’s understated at first glance, but unmistakable once you know what you’re looking at.
Why this dial stands out
Lavender dials occupy a quiet but important corner of vintage Rolex collecting. They weren’t loud or experimental; they were simply uncommon, produced briefly and in small quantities. The color sits somewhere between silver and purple, shifting gently depending on the light and giving the watch depth without pulling focus away from its clean Oyster Perpetual layout.
Set against the smooth steel bezel and balanced case proportions, the dial adds individuality while keeping the watch grounded and wearable. It remains a classic ref. 1500 in form, just with a far less frequently encountered face.
Condition, clearly stated
Condition on this example is notably strong. The case remains unpolished, retaining its original shape and finish with only light wear consistent with age. The dial is original and presents cleanly, with an even surface and no distracting flaws. The crystal is clear, and the overall presentation feels cohesive and well preserved.
The watch is fitted to its Rolex Oyster rivet bracelet, which wears comfortably and is fully appropriate to the period. Mechanically, the automatic movement is fully functional and keeping time as expected, with all core components remaining original.
